Read FIDO Device Metadata - single fido2 device
GET {{apiPath}}/environments/{{envID}}/fidoDevicesMetadata/{{fidoDeviceID}}
Use GET {{apiPath}}/environments/{{envID}}/fidoDevicesMetadata/{{fidoDeviceID}} to retrieve the metadata for a specific device in the Global Authenticators table.
The device ID can be taken from the mdsIdentifier field for the device in the list of devices returned when you retrieve all of the device metadata in the Global Authenticators table. The ID of each device is also displayed in the Global Authenticators table in the UI (in the column Metadata ID).
This example retrieves the data for a device compliant with the FIDO2 protocol, so the returned data will also include the aaguid field.
